A new app apparently makes it possible for people to delete text messages they’ve sent other people from other people’s phones.
The “Privates!” application was developed to be a highly secure messaging app, with primary features being an alert if the recipient tries to screenshot the message and the ability to “unsend” messages if the recipient hasn’t read them yet.
The “unsend” happens after three, 12, and 24 hours, depending on the settings the user selects.
Or they can recall a message at any time if they change their mind about the message that was sent, according to a press release.
The service attempts to prevent people from screenshotting, saying it has stronger security than potential rivals such as Snapchat and Whatsapp.
